Message type: E = Error
Message class: BORGR - Messages Multi-Level Goods Receipt
Message number: 079
Message text: Additional information

- Additional information ?The SAP error message BORGR079 typically indicates that there is an issue related to the Business Object Repository (BOR) in SAP. This error can occur in various contexts, often when there is a problem with the configuration or usage of Business Objects in SAP.
Cause:
- Missing or Incomplete Configuration: The error may arise if the Business Object is not properly configured or if there are missing components.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access the Business Object or perform the required action.
- Incorrect Object Type: The error can occur if the system is trying to access an object that does not exist or is of an incorrect type.
- Data Inconsistencies: There may be inconsistencies in the data related to the Business Object, leading to the error.
Solution:
- Check Configuration: Review the configuration of the Business Object in the SAP system. Ensure that all necessary components are correctly set up.
- Verify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the appropriate authorizations to access the Business Object. This can be done by checking the user roles and authorizations in the system.
- Validate Object Existence: Confirm that the Business Object being accessed exists and is of the correct type. You can use transaction codes like SWO1 (Business Object Builder) to check the object.
- Review Logs: Check the system logs for any additional error messages or information that may provide more context about the issue.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ific Business Object you are working with for any known issues or additional troubleshooting steps.
-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ists and you cannot resolve it,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ance.
